Portland, Maine, offers access to excellent higher education opportunities. The city and surrounding region are home to public and private colleges and universities known for strong programs in marine science, liberal arts, technology, and healthcare professions.
Top Public Colleges & Universities in Portland, ME
University of Southern Maine (USM) – With its main campus in Portland, USM is a leading public university in Maine offering diverse undergraduate and graduate programs. Known for strong programs in nursing, business, education, and the arts, it also boasts a growing research profile and community engagement.
Southern Maine Community College (SMCC) – Located in nearby South Portland, SMCC is the state’s largest community college. It offers quality associate degree and certificate programs with strengths in marine science, health sciences, culinary arts, and applied technology fields.
University of Maine School of Law – Known as Maine Law, this public law school is part of the University of Maine System and located in downtown Portland. It offers a strong legal education with programs in environmental law, immigration law, and public interest law.
University of Maine at Augusta – Lewiston Center (nearby) – A regional campus offering flexible degree options and online classes. Students can pursue programs in business, justice studies, and public administration while remaining close to Portland.
University College at Portland – Part of the University of Maine System’s distance education network, this center connects students to dozens of programs from across the state’s public universities, making higher education more accessible for Portland residents.
Top Private Colleges & Universities in Portland, ME
University of New England (UNE) – Headquartered in Biddeford with a major campus in Portland, UNE is a top private university known for its healthcare programs, including medicine, pharmacy, dental medicine, and nursing. It’s also recognized for its commitment to research and community-focused education.
MECA&D – Maine College of Art & Design – Located in the heart of Portland, MECA&D is a private art college offering bachelor’s and master’s degrees in fine arts, graphic design, illustration, and more. It plays a vibrant role in Portland’s dynamic creative community.
Saint Joseph’s College of Maine – Although located in Standish, just outside Portland, this private Catholic college draws many students from the region. Known for programs in nursing, education, and business, the college also offers a wide range of online degree options.
Institute for Doctoral Studies in the Visual Arts (IDSVA) – A unique low-residency PhD program based in Portland, IDSVA caters to artists and scholars interested in advanced studies of philosophy, aesthetics, and art theory. It has become a nationally respected institution within art education circles.
